词汇 floor-to-ceiling
释义 floor-to-ceiling
adjective[ before noun ]
uk /ˌflɔː.təˈsiː.lɪŋ/ us /ˌflɔːr.təˈsiː.lɪŋ/
used for describing things such as windows or pieces of furniture that are the full height of a wall: 由地面至顶棚的(窗户或家具等)
floor-to-ceiling shelves/cupboards由地面建至顶棚的架子/柜子
